Kitchen Utensil Holders Shopping Guide



If you are a beginner to shopping for kitchen utensil holders, there are a few things you should consider before making your purchase. To help you get started, here is a beginner’s shopping guide:

1. Consider the type of utensils you need to store. Different types of utensils need different types of holders. For example, holders for knives will be different than holders for spatulas. Make sure you get a holder that will fit your utensils properly.

2. Determine the size of the holder you need. Utensil holders come in a variety of sizes. If you want to store a large number of utensils, you may need a larger holder. Or, if you only need to store a few pieces, a smaller holder may be more suitable.

3. Think about the style of holder you would like. Do you want something modern and sleek? Or maybe something with a more traditional look? There are a wide variety of styles available, so take the time to find one that fits your home’s decor.

4. Check out the materials of the holder. Common materials used in utensil holders are wood, metal, and plastic. Each material has its own benefits and drawbacks. Wood provides a classic look but can be prone to scratches and water damage. Metal is long-lasting and durable, but can be heavy. Plastic is lightweight and easy to clean, but some people don’t like the look of it.

5. Consider the price. Utensil holders range in price from very affordable to quite expensive. Take into account how often you will use the holder and how many utensils you need to store. That way, you can determine what type of holder would be the best value for your needs.
